Who is the “Commonwealth Attorney” aka Prosecutor?

0

Prosecution refers to the government’s role in the criminal justice system. When criminal activity is suspected, it is up to the government to investigate, arrest, charge and bring the alleged offender to trial. Prosecutors are the lawyers who work for the government and who are responsible for presenting the government’s case against a defendant. Prosecutors may be called Virginia Commonwealth attorneys, city prosecutors, or town prosecutors.
